  • Publication number: 20070090209
    Abstract: The method is used for refining a paper fiber suspension (S). This is refined chiefly by compressive forces between two refining surfaces (1, 2) that lie on refiner tools pressed against one another, since the refiner tools in the refining zone do not move or move very little relative to one another. The refining surfaces (1, 2) are embodied to be porous so that they can temporarily absorb or discharge part of the water (W) of the paper fiber suspension (S). An arrangement with central refiner cylinder (3) and refiner rolls (4) arranged on the periphery is particularly suitable as a device for carrying out the method. The refining surfaces can be embodied cylindrically or they can be provided with a toothing.

  • Patent number: 6073865
    Abstract: A process is disclosed that is utilized in particular in the preparation of fibrous material of used paper. Hot fibrous pulp friable materials, which are especially suitable for dispersing, are first formed in a compact, high-consistency fibrous material in the form of a plug. In a preferred embodiment, the plug of materials is pushed against a rotor that is equipped with pulverization elements. The pulverization elements remove the fibrous pulp friable materials and distribute them in a disintegrated condition in a processing chamber. In the processing chamber, super-heated vapor is supplied via vapor supply lines, which calefies the fibrous pulp friable materials, for example, by condensation.

  • Patent number: 5730376
    Abstract: The invention is directed to a processing apparatus which can be used, for example, to disperse highly consistent fibrous paper substances. The apparatus consists of at least two intermeshed processing tools (1, 2), which are movable with respect to one another and which are provided with teeth (3, 3', 3", 4, 4"). The fibrous substance that is being processed passes along a gap between the processing tools and finally leaves the apparatus through an expulsion mechanism (8) that allows the adjustment of the size of the exit opening through which the substance exits. The control of the size of the exit opening allows control over the degree of compression acting on the substance and the fill level of the apparatus, both of which in effect control the process intensity.

  • Patent number: 5406883
    Abstract: A process is proposed for the dewatering of compressibly dewaterable materials, in particular waste from the processing of paper material, which enables a very high degree of dewatering so that the waste can be readily disposed of, e.g. dumped. For this purpose, the material to be dewatered is initially pre-dewatered by gravity, and usually also by compression, in a transportation section (5). This pre-dewatering can take place in a continually operating feed section (7) through a perforated sieve jacket (10). The material then reaches a press section (6) in which a discontinuously working pressing device is in operation. Further improvements in the dewatering performance are possible by various embodiments of the corresponding pressing elements (13,14). The invention relates to both the process and the device for implemention of the process.
